The new Agricultural Waste Regulations represent a challenge to the industry but also an opportunity to use our skills and ingenuity to keep waste disposal costs down and help protect the environment. This farm waste management booklet can help farmers to find local companies to recycle their farm waste rather than sending it to landfill. It also gives tried and tested waste saving tips from other Norfolk farmers to help avoid waste in the first place. The benefits are huge, both to farmers, who save money on waste disposal costs, and to Norfolk’s environment.
Inside you will find useful information about the new Agricultural Waste Regulations and the options now available for dealing with your farm waste. This directory also contains details of waste management companies offering farm waste recycling services in Norfolk, along with ideas to help you reduce your waste disposal costs and divert waste from landfill.
NRBAS worked jointly with Norfolk County Council to research the introduction of the Agricultural Waste Regulation and its effects on the county’s waste streams and the county’s farmers.
